Skip to content

vanng822/css

Folders and files

NameName
Last commit message
Last commit date
May 7, 2024
Feb 27, 2015
Feb 26, 2015
Mar 3,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Mar 3, 2021
Nov 25, 2024
Nov 25, 2024
Mar 6,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Apr 26, 2019
Feb 16, 2018
Mar 1, 2021
Feb 15, 2018
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Mar 1, 2021
Feb 16, 2018
Mar 2, 2021
Mar 2, 2021

Repository files navigation

css

Package css is for parsing css stylesheet.

Document

GoDoc

example

import (
	"github.com/vanng822/css"
	"fmt"
)
func main() {
	csstext := "td {width: 100px; height: 100px;}"
	ss := css.Parse(csstext)
	rules := ss.GetCSSRuleList()
	for _, rule := range rules {
		fmt.Println(rule.Style.Selector.Text())
		fmt.Println(rule.Style.Styles)
	}
}